Suspect dead after shooting outside district court in Delaware County

Friday, June 28, 2019
LOWER CHICHESTER, Pa. (WPVI) -- A suspect is dead after a shooting outside a district court building in Delaware County.

The shooting happened outside the building in the 500 block of Ridge Road in the Linwood section of Lower Chichester Township around 10:30 a.m. Friday.

The suspect has been identified as 34-year-old Darren Williams of Chester, Pa.

Authorities say Williams was pulled over by police on Thursday night. Police say he appeared to be under the influence and failed a field sobriety test.

He became combative with officers and had to be tased. He was then taken into custody.

On Friday morning, Williams was arraigned at the district court office. After his arraignment, officials say Williams pushed past two officers and tried to run away.

There was a struggle with officers and Williams got his hands on a gun. During the struggle, police say Williams shot himself. He was also shot by one of the officers.

District Attorney Kat Copeland said it does not appear Williams' self-inflicted gunshot wound was intentional.

Copeland said investigators are talking to witnesses and reviewing surveillance video as the investigation continues.

Family members of Darren Williams are requesting to see the surveillance video of the incident and are asking that an independent prosecutor be put on the case.

Williams' family says he had a criminal record but was "easy-going." He was the father of two.
